1. Overview
Edito A1 is an A1-level French language coursebook designed for adult and young-adult learners beginning French. The updated PDF edition modernizes content and presentation to align with contemporary communicative teaching approaches, focusing on practical vocabulary, everyday situations, and basic grammar structures. The course typically covers listening, speaking, reading, and writing skills at CEFR A1.

What’s new in the updated PDF
- Revised lesson sequencing: Topics have been reordered for clearer progression from basic vocabulary to simple communicative tasks.
- Updated dialogues and audio references: Conversations reflect more natural, contemporary usage and include updated audio track listings.
- Expanded exercises: More scaffolded practice on speaking, listening, reading, and writing with step-by-step support for beginners.
- Extra cultural notes: Short, accessible cultural snippets added to several chapters to increase real-world context.
- Improved layout and accessibility: Larger fonts, clearer spacing, and enhanced tagging for screen readers in the PDF version.
